Global Commercial & Industrial Demand for RJ45 Connectors with LEDs

Analyzing the evolution of hardware diagnostic systems in contemporary Ethernet ecosystems.

01

Modern Datacenter & Cloud Telemetry

In high-density server racks and hyperscale architectures, immediate visual diagnostics are paramount. RJ45 connectors featuring integrated LEDs eliminate the need for secondary indicator lamps on the network interface cards (NICs), substantially shrinking PCB trace lengths and simplifying complex system architecture layouts.

02

Industrial Automation & Smart Factories

Under Harsh Environmental Conditions (HEC) of Smart Factories, mechanical strain and electromagnetic interference (EMI) threaten network links. Integrated LED lights serve as the first line of diagnostic triage, giving site engineers instant validation of physical-layer connection and transfer speed status.

03

IoT Deployment & Edge Infrastructure

As IoT gateways proliferate, developers require compact, rugged, and intelligent interface solutions. The convergence of LED illumination, magnetics (for noise isolation), and standard modular formats provides the reliable hardware foundation needed for smart grids and municipal edge systems.

Engineering Specifications & Material Quality Standards

The standard composition of a premium RJ45 connector, built to survive thousands of mating cycles without packet dropouts.

Specification Parameter Standard Industry Grade Lumetra Premium Grade Performance Benefit
Gold Plating Thickness 3u" to 15u" (micro-inches) 30u" to 50u" Selective Gold Prevents contact oxidation and extends mating lifespan to >750 cycles.
Housing Material Standard PBT Plastic LCP (Liquid Crystal Polymer) UL94V-0 Withstands high-temperature reflow soldering processes up to 260°C.
Shielding Type Single-piece Brass, Tin-plated Nickel/Copper Alloy Shield with EMI Tabs Superior grounding performance; dramatically reduces electromagnetic leakage.
PoE Compatibility PoE (802.3af) PoE+ / PoE++ (Up to 90W) Minimizes local heat buildup in high-wattage power transmission.
LED Configuration Monocolor (Green/Yellow) Bi-color / Integrated Resistor Options Enhanced visual diagnostic flexibility directly matching custom logic layouts.

Signal Integrity and Crosstalk Cancellation (NEXT & FEXT)

When routing high-speed differential pairs (TX and RX lines) beside internal LED control lines, signal degradation is a critical concern. If the design does not feature optimized internal pin separation, switching the LED state can induce capacitive coupling onto the high-speed data pairs, causing packet loss. Emerging Trends in High-Speed Ethernet & RJ45 Connectors

Analyzing key technology vectors changing modular connector specifications.

Heat-Dissipating Design for PoE++

As Power-over-Ethernet requirements hit 90W (Type 4 PoE++), temperature rises within connector housings can degrade insulating performance. High-performance connectors must feature thermocontrol properties and optimized air gaps to ensure the integrated LEDs do not suffer from thermal output degradation or color shifting.

Evolution of Multi-Color Indicators

Modern engineering designs call for dynamic status display. Bidirectional LEDs with tri-state configurations (e.g., Green for gigabit connection, Yellow for Fast Ethernet connection, Flashing for activity, Red/Orange for network error diagnostics) are increasingly standard, saving PCB layout space and reducing BOM counts.

Rugged Shielding against EMI

With high-frequency applications like Cat6a (up to 500 MHz) and Cat8 (up to 2 GHz), shielding performance is critical. Advanced RJ45 connectors feature wrap-around metal shells, integrated ground pins, and custom EMI gaskets to isolate high-frequency noise from close-coupled cables.

Information Gain Note: High frequency operation combined with poor magnetic component termination inside MagJacks can lead to differential-to-common mode conversion. This is the primary driver of EMC test failures in networking devices. Purchasing components with pre-certified, built-in common-mode chokes is highly recommended for design engineers.

Enterprise Sourcing Checklist: RJ45 Connectors with LEDs

A technical guide for procurement directors evaluating supplier capabilities in East Asia.

1. Mechanical Evaluation

  • Mating cycles specification (>750 insertions minimum)
  • Retention force strength (>133N latch retention test)
  • Mechanical tolerance compliance with FCC Part 68.500

2. Optical & Electrical Check

  • LED Forward Current (typically 20mA maximum)
  • Reverse voltage limits (minimum 5V tolerance)
  • Dielectric strength (minimum 1000 Vrms between contacts)

3. Environmental & Compliance

  • Lead-free solder process compatibility
  • RoHS directive compliance and REACH statement
  • Salt spray corrosion testing (minimum 24-48 hours)

Technical Q&A: Understanding RJ45 with LED Connectors

Addressing engineering and sourcing questions regarding modular network interfaces.

What is the benefit of integrating magnetics inside the RJ45 modular jack housing?

An integrated magnetic connector (commonly called a Magjack) houses the isolation transformer and common-mode choke within the shielded metal housing of the RJ45 unit. This architecture reduces PCB footprint by up to 40%, enhances EMI suppression performance, protects downstream PHY chips from electrostatic discharges (ESD) and electrical surges, and optimizes high-speed signal pathways.

How does gold-plating thickness affect the long-term reliability of RJ45 interfaces?

Gold is highly conductive and resistant to oxidation. A thin layer (e.g., gold flash or 3u") is cost-effective but wears away after limited insertion cycles, leading to high contact resistance and signal dropouts in humid or corrosive environments. Industry standards for critical telecom equipment mandate 30u" to 50u" of gold plating over nickel barriers to ensure physical-layer integrity over a typical 10-to-15-year operational lifecycle.

Can LED RJ45 connectors support modern PoE (Power over Ethernet) configurations?

Yes. Modern systems require components to handle high currents (up to 600mA or 960mA per pair for PoE+ and PoE++). Ensure the connector manufacturer specifies a high-temperature polymer body (like LCP) and optimized contact designs to handle the mating/unmating spark associated with active power delivery.

What LED colors are standard, and is custom configuration available?

The industry standard configuration features a Green LED on one side (typically indicating active Link status) and a Yellow/Amber LED on the opposite side (indicating network Activity or transmission speed). In ODM/OEM projects, colors can be customized to include Red, Blue, or dual-color combinations (e.g., Green/Orange or Green/Yellow) with distinct forward voltages and voltage thresholds.
